1、数据库备份及恢复注意事项
SHOW VARIABLES WHERE variable_name IN (
'log_bin_trust_function_creators',
'transaction_isolation',
'lower_case_table_names',
'sql_mode',
'character_set_server',
'default_character_set',
'innodb_large_prefix',
'max_connections',
'innodb_buffer_pool_size',
'group_concat_max_len'
);
character-set-server=utf8
innodb_buffer_pool_size=512M ###动态参数,系统内存的1/4即可
log_bin_trust_function_creators=1
lower_case_table_names = 1
max_connections = 2000 ###动态参数,根据实际的用户量进行调整即可,最低要求300
sql_mode=NO_ENGINE_SUBSTITUTION,STRICT_TRANS_TABLES
transaction_isolation = READ-COMMITTED
group_concat_max_len = 102400
2、图片及流程附件等文件路径修正
如果路径与原来的路径有变化,需要修改数据库路径信息。
先查一下路径指向
select filerealpath from ImageFile
例如:原路径D:\weaver改成了D:\OASource-Backup\weaver。部分数据库需注意大小写。
UPDATE ImageFile SET filerealpath = REPLACE(filerealpath, 'd:\\weaver', 'd:\\oasource-backup\\weaver')